JOB PURPOSE
To lead and manage mechanical, electrical, instrumentation and utility maintenance of the pyrolysis plant, ensuring maximum equipment availability, safe operation, minimum breakdowns and uninterrupted production.
KEY RESPONSIBILITIES
- Plan and supervise preventive, predictive and breakdown maintenance activities.
- Ensure reliable operation of pyrolysis reactors, heating systems, condensers, cooling systems, pumps, compressors, blowers, conveyors, feeders and gas/oil handling systems.
- Troubleshoot and maintain motors, gearboxes, MCC/control panels, electrical systems, PLC/SCADA and instrumentation.
- Prepare daily, weekly, monthly and annual preventive maintenance schedules.
- Identify recurring failures and conduct Root Cause Analysis (RCA) to prevent repeat breakdowns.
- Maintain equipment history, breakdown records, maintenance checklists and KPI reports.
- Prepare and maintain critical spare-parts lists and coordinate with Stores/Purchase for timely availability.
- Lead and supervise mechanical, electrical and instrumentation technicians and allocate manpower effectively.
- Ensure proper LOTO, work permits, PPE and maintenance safety procedures are followed.
- Coordinate emergency breakdown maintenance and minimize production downtime.
- Monitor calibration and proper functioning of temperature, pressure, level and flow instruments.
- Coordinate AMC/vendor/service activities and statutory maintenance requirements.
- Control maintenance costs without compromising equipment reliability and safety.
- Conduct toolbox meetings and train maintenance personnel in safe working practices.
